
Image file storage destinations and file names
The image files recorded with your camera are grouped as folders on the recording medium.
Example: viewing folders on Windows XP
AFolders containing image data recorded using this camera. (The first three digits show the folder number.)
BYou can create a folder by date form (page 100).
•You cannot record/play back any images to the “MISC” folder.
•If you delete folder except the latest folder in file browser index screen, the folder number becomes an unused number.
•Image files are named as follows. ssss (file number) stands for any number within the range from 0001 to 9999. The numerical portions of the name of a RAW data file and its corresponding JPEG image file are the same.
–JPEG files: DSC0ssss.JPG
–JPEG files (Adobe RGB): _DSCssss.JPG
–RAW data file (other than Adobe RGB): DSC0ssss.ARW
–RAW data file (Adobe RGB): _DSCssss.ARW
•The extension may not be displayed depending on the computer.
